Saka misses Arsenal-Bournemouth amid injury
Briefly

Bukayo Saka has been left out of the Arsenal squad for the upcoming match against Bournemouth after suffering a hamstring injury while playing for England. This development is significant given that Saka had been a crucial player for Arsenal, contributing to every game so far this season with an impressive tally of 10 goals in 10 appearances. His absence could have implications for the team's performance and tactics.
Mikel Merino, the new signing, has made his first start for Arsenal in place of Saka. This decision draws attention as Merino’s integration into the squad during such a key match may influence the team's dynamics. Furthermore, Raheem Sterling has filled in for Saka in the starting lineup, suggesting a possible shift in formation or strategy as Arsenal prepares to face Bournemouth.
